Transaction 85eafda686752bc369d7e79886493442a86a94cddde432609da7303ea03580c2
1 Input
1 Output
-
85eafda686752bc369d7e79886493442a86a94cddde432609da7303ea03580c2:0
- value
- 1684730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afc4465d962c9cf159d0e2a7479de1c45bbcc79b OP_EQUAL
- address
- 3HiPJXjujJvntktFGjWuP6FJnZFD2FAe3i